
STRENGTH AND DURABILITY MALOSSI CRANKSHAFTS FOR VESPA
The Vespa crankshaft is one of the most delicate and fundamental components of this type of power unit, as it has to control both the movements of the connecting rod and the piston, as well as regulate the intake using the timing mechanism.
The Malossi technical department has paid particular attention to these two aspects, creating two versions of crankshafts and developing new solutions of high technical value, starting with the selection of the materials, which, as always, are of the highest quality.
All Malossi crankshafts for Vespa are made of hardened, vacuum-melted steel of aeronautical quality, a material that is highly resistant to scratches and is guaranteed by the certifications required by strict Malossi specifications TheĀ connecting rod with a āviper headāĀ has a sophisticated design to absorb maximum weight and guarantee theĀ required strength.
Not even the smallest detail has been overlooked. Malossi engineers have in fact been able to significantly increase resistance by using a finer thread on the axle on the drive side of the crankshafts The position of the spanner has also been revised in terms of both size and shape to no longer damage the thread and to contribute to the resistance with a modern solution. The crankshafts are fitted with special nuts that are much more resistant in order to benefit from the highest resistance that the densest thread can offer.

SHAFT WITH FULL COLLAR
The Malossi shaft with full collar is designed solely for Vespa engines that have been modified to use an intake system with a reed valve instead of the original rotary valve. These engines represent the new limit for Vespa enthusiasts.
Just like for the version with a rotary valve, the optimum balance is ensured by tungsten inserts. In addition, the back of the drive side has specially developed bevels to facilitate the intake of fresh gases into the lower housing.
TheĀ circular ground structureĀ is the area that benefits most from this new shaft and housing configuration, as it receives theĀ highest possible amount of pressureĀ at all times.
